Mumbai, May 7 (PTI) Freo, a fintech, on Thursday announced the acquisition of Indialends for an undisclosed sum to expand its scale of operations.

The deal brings together Freo's consumer financial platform and Indialends' marketplace and will take the number of people it can serve to 5 crore, as per a statement.

EXIM Bank signs issuing bank agreement with Mongolia's Golomt Bank


* The Export-Import Bank of India on Thursday said it has signed an issuing bank agreement with Mongolia's Golomt Bank for supporting trade transactions.

The agreement under India Exim Bank's Trade Assistance Programme (TAP) was signed on the sidelines of the Asian Development Bank (ADB) Annual Meetings at Samarkand, Uzbekistan, as per a statement.

Paynearby facilitates Rs 550 cr gold loan disbursals in FY26 from small retail stores

* Amid a surge in gold loans, Paynearby on Thursday said it has facilitated disbursals against the precious commodity worth Rs 550 crore in FY26 from small retail stores.

A bulk of the distribution is from semi-urban and rural regions, it said in a statement, adding that Rs 100 crore was disbursed in March 2026 alone.
